VIDHS Division of Senior Citizens Affairs Offices Temporarily Close for Mold Remediation

The Department of Human Services is located behind the Lionel Roberts Stadium on St. Thomas. (Source photo by Bethaney Lee)

The Virgin Islands Department of Human Services Division of Senior Citizens Affairs has temporarily closed its offices in the Knud Hansen Complex in Hospital Ground due to necessary mold remediation efforts. This closure is a proactive measure to ensure the health and safety of its staff, senior citizens and the community.

During this period, the division remains committed to providing uninterrupted services to senior citizens and stakeholders. The department encourages the community to reach out to the following contacts for specific information and assistance:

– Homemakers: 725-6216

– Information and Referral: 725-6215

– Nutrition: 725-6264 or 725-4851

– RSVP/FPG: 725-6206

– SCSEP: 725-6210

The Division of Senior Citizens Affairs is working diligently to complete the remediation process as swiftly as possible and to ensure that its offices are safe for everyone.

Updates regarding the reopening of the Knud Hansen offices will be provided as soon as they are available. The Department of Human Services thanks the community for its patience and support.
